{"_id":"5b57eaf1e0537300036b4743","project":"568bdc1483d2061900d86cdc","version":{"_id":"59a72290d61777001b6c42c3","project":"568bdc1483d2061900d86cdc","__v":33,"createdAt":"2017-08-30T20:39:44.453Z","releaseDate":"2017-08-30T20:39:44.453Z","categories":["59a7236e3fe4d90025117c10","59a72eb6cb0db3001b84cfe2","59a734eb757d030019b85af8","59c0243b1b2d07001a9d2b76","59c035e42126e10028effb12","59c06c40df5b3c0010584a13","59c1a5852cabe5002641a3e7","59c2fb00b2b45c0010b7a3d7","59c32ceb9aea850010ac4130","59c32e6e190c90003cb0d12f","59c33affb2b45c0010b7aa23","59c7dfa457bd8200105444dc","59c7e975c50cf30010d712a0","59cffdef0cd4dd0010294d54","59d0622ca91a810032c8f60c","59d06733c1aec60026253065","59d174d44ac471001a07b123","59d5a5e323e6e800103defb2","59ecf1d8ed507c001c52b255","59f76fef8581dc0010593e6f","5a0c003680a35b0012c35db0","5a8358722e78660075e45f42","5a846645b5ec3a001203517e","5b258091bc7a6700033b9cb5","5b26e48e024807000315a740","5b44edff3306680003663f5c","5b468abd3d4a9e0003789111","5b468d8f3dcb6a0003c6e374","5b47b0b93d4a9e000378a33a","5b538d114ea24f00033c726f","5b6a0efe402b32000336c33f","5bba5e5d7ba7710003bd902a","5bc2703349ac3a0013eec3e5"],"is_deprecated":false,"is_hidden":false,"is_beta":true,"is_stable":true,"codename":"","version_clean":"0.0.0","version":"0"},"category":{"_id":"59c1a5852cabe5002641a3e7","project":"568bdc1483d2061900d86cdc","version":"59a72290d61777001b6c42c3","__v":0,"sync":{"url":"","isSync":false},"reference":false,"createdAt":"2017-09-19T23:17:25.014Z","from_sync":false,"order":20,"slug":"ecosystems-a","title":"Ecosystems API"},"user":"5a6a26281895510045b2cd40","githubsync":"","__v":9,"parentDoc":null,"updates":[],"next":{"pages":[],"description":""},"createdAt":"2018-07-25T03:13:53.100Z","link_external":false,"link_url":"","sync_unique":"","hidden":false,"api":{"method":"post","examples":{"codes":[{"code":"POST https://ioe.droplit.io/api/ecosystems/C5aebfea1278b9bfe02639d21/behaviors/C5aebfea1278b9bfe02639d21;eco_sample/actions/turn-on-lights/start HTTP/1.1\nauthorization: AUTH_TOKEN\n\n{\n\t\"parameters\" : {\n  \t\":::at:::device\" : \"D5b99ebf892b2fef169b8c2e7\",\n    \"@group\" : [\n    \t\"D5b195b08a2922e816cb872e1\",\n      \"D5b1853075589c66a89e7cbe3\"\n    ],\n    \"@value\" : {\n    \t\"number\" : 50,\n      \"boolean\" : true\n    }\n  }\n}","language":"http"}]},"settings":"59a75ffc4836990031f5ec2f","results":{"codes":[{"code":"","language":"text","name":"Ecosystem Not Found","status":404},{"code":"","language":"text","name":"Behavior Not Found","status":404},{"code":"","language":"text","name":"Action Not Found","status":404}]},"auth":"required","params":[{"_id":"5b57e8372c92e400034b7bfa","ref":"","in":"path","required":true,"desc":"The ID of the ecosystem.","default":"","type":"string","name":"id"},{"_id":"5b57e8372c92e400034b7bf9","ref":"","in":"header","required":true,"desc":"The user's authorization token.","default":"","type":"string","name":"authorization"},{"_id":"5b57f4e858555d0003a9e775","ref":"","in":"path","required":true,"desc":"The ID of the behavior.","default":"","type":"string","name":"behaviorId"},{"_id":"5b57f4e858555d0003a9e774","ref":"","in":"path","required":true,"desc":"The name of the action to be started.","default":"","type":"string","name":"actionName"},{"_id":"5b5b6dbeb22ba300037b40c7","ref":"","in":"body","required":false,"desc":"Custom parameters for a particular action within a behavior. The values of these parameters override the values established when the behavior was enabled.","default":"","type":"object","name":"parameters"}],"url":"/:id/behaviors/:behaviorId/actions/:actionName/start"},"isReference":false,"order":25,"body":"","excerpt":"Execute a particular action within a behavior.","slug":"start-an-action-1","type":"endpoint","title":"Start an action."}

postStart an action.

Execute a particular action within a behavior.

Definition

{{ api_url }}{{ page_api_url }}

Parameters

Path Params

id:
required
string
The ID of the ecosystem.
behaviorId:
required
string
The ID of the behavior.
actionName:
required
string
The name of the action to be started.

Body Params

parameters:
object
Custom parameters for a particular action within a behavior. The values of these parameters override the values established when the behavior was enabled.

Headers

authorization:
required
string
The user's authorization token.

Examples


User Information

Try It Out

post
{{ tryResults.results }}
Method{{ tryResults.method }}
Request Headers
{{ tryResults.requestHeaders }}
URL{{ tryResults.url }}
Request Data
{{ tryResults.data }}
Status
Response Headers
{{ tryResults.responseHeaders }}